To properly apply polyurethane to a wooden surface for a durable and protective finish, follow these steps:
- Sand the wood surface to remove any imperfections and create a smooth surface.
- Clean the surface to remove any dust or debris.
- Apply a coat of polyurethane using a high-quality brush or applicator, following the wood grain.
- Allow the first coat to dry completely before lightly sanding with fine-grit sandpaper.
- Apply additional coats of polyurethane, sanding between each coat for a smooth finish.
- Allow the final coat to dry completely before using the wooden surface.
